Transaction 18dff2291ad073cd79551f577e6a0455267d7af322decd396085ee4fc1081189
1 Input
1 Output
-
18dff2291ad073cd79551f577e6a0455267d7af322decd396085ee4fc1081189:0
- value
- 153998
- script pubkey
- OP_0 OP_PUSHBYTES_20 a40e759141b4ce68ea0c7fdddfdeeec1e334478e
- address
- bc1q5s88ty2pkn8x36sv0lwalhhwc83ng3uw0h69md